MVP Track Time 2010 Track Dates and Invitation
 
2010 MVP Track Time Schedule


Good Day All:

MVP Track Time (www.MVPTrackTime.com) is pleased to announce our 2010 track events.

MVP has again kept pricing the same as the previous year. With the continuing economic news, I hope this reaches you as good news. We aim to bring the best track value to you with more track time at each event for less money.

Below you will find our 2010 schedule, subject to possible revision as the year progresses. Look for the addition of more track events throughout 2010.

April 10 – 11: Putnam Park (Greencastle, IN.) - SOLD OUT!

June 7: Autobahn Country Club (Joliet, IL) - SOLD OUT!

August 9: Autobahn Country Club II (Joliet, IL) (FULL 3.56 mile track)

September 18 - 19: Eagles Canyon Raceway (Decatur, TX) - “Cars of Northern Aggression”

October 16 – 17: Road America (Elkhart Lake, WI) – “Cheese Heads on Track”

November 20 – 21: Road Atlanta (Braselton, GA) - “2nd Annual Flyin’ Turkey Trot”

Good Morning All:

We've received a number of e-mails and calls asking about entry fees for MVP Track Time's (www.MVPTrackTime.com) 2010 track events. They are on our web site as well, so no one is "surprised”. The 2010 dates and entry fees are listed below.

April 10 - 11: Putnam Park - SOLD OUT!

June 7: Autobahn Country Club (FULL 3.56 mile track) - SOLD OUT!

August 9: Autobahn Country Club II (FULL 3.56 mile track) - $245

September 18 - 19: Eagles Canyon -
$325-Weekend
$235-Single Day


October 16 - 17: Road America
$375-Weekend
$250-Single Day


November 20 - 21: Road Atlanta
$400-Weekend
$250-Single Day



All info and registration is available on our "Track Day Registration" page of the web site at:
http://www.MVPTrackTime.com/id47.html
We schedule six, 20-minute run sessions for each of the three run groups daily. Complimentary, qualified instructors are available for the Novice drivers..
